Association Football. Pt. 1. Methods of coaching

United Kingdom, 1941

Film
Please note

Sorry, we don't have images or video for this item.

Instructional film looking at the skills involved in the game of football (soccer). Shows football players involved in a range of drills including ball control, striking, passing etc. Also includes footage of England vs Wales (c1940s). Commentary by Raymond Glendenning.
